in⋅tro⋅gres⋅sion

[in-truh-gresh-uhn]
–noun Genetics.
the introduction of genes from one species into the gene pool of another species, occurring when matings between the two produce fertile hybrids.
Also called in⋅tro⋅gres⋅sive hybridiza⋅tion [in-truh-gres-iv] .


Origin:
1930–35 (earlier in literal sense of L); < L intrōgress(us), ptp. of intrōgredī to go in, enter (intrō- intro- + -gred-, comb. form of grad(ī) to proceed, walk + -tus ptp. suffix, with -dt- > -ss-) + -ion
